LIFE IS GOOD

Let me out of the country,
let me take me a friend
and we'll send you a postcard,
with 'all our love' on the end
then we'll laze in the season,
maybe swim in the sea
and we'll talk in the moonlight
just you and me.

Life is good, why don't we spread it around
like we should, it's a beautiful sound.

If the world should come calling
we'll retreat to the house,
and we'll light us a fire
be as quiet as a mouse,
then we'll talk of the daytime
maybe plan for the morn,
giving in to the evening
being glad we were born.

Life is good, why don't we spread it around
like we should, it's a beautiful sound.

I believe in the universe
it's a song I accept,
and I know that life promises
should always be kept,
I love every moment
that's been given to me,
and if you will take it
then here is the key,

Life is good, why don't we spread it around
like we should, it's a beautiful sound.
